    The error message you are encountering in SAP, specifically "HRPADCZ_DECO132 èpatnT datum narozenf - datum v rodnTm #fsle," translates to "Invalid date of birth - date in the birth certificate." This error typically arises in the context of personnel administration or human resources modules when there is a discrepancy or invalid entry related to an employee's date of birth.

    Causes:

    1. Incorrect Date Format: The date of birth may not be entered in the expected format (e.g., DD/MM/YYYY vs. MM/DD/YYYY).
    2. Invalid Date: The date entered may not be a valid date (e.g., February 30).
    3. Mismatch with Other Records: The date of birth entered may not match with other records, such as those in the employee's personal data or official documents.
    4. Data Entry Errors: Simple typographical errors during data entry can lead to this issue.

    Solutions:

    1. Check Date Format: Ensure that the date of birth is entered in the correct format as required by the system.
    2. Validate the Date: Verify that the date entered is a valid date and corresponds to the actual birth date of the employee.
    3. Cross-Check Records: Compare the date of birth in the SAP system with official documents (like birth certificates) to ensure consistency.
    4. Correct Data Entry: If there are any typographical errors, correct them and re-enter the date of birth.
